						Hi, new to the forum and have just bought a 2008 Discovery 3. Just wondering if anyone can help out, I’ve got a GAP iid tool and keep this message
B1D21-13 (2F) Remote control switch
General electrical failure - circuit open
I keep clearing it and it keeps coming back. I’ve gone through and checked the earth points, checked the transfer case module for corrosion and all looks good. I have just replaced the alternator and the battery is still strong..Every now and then the radio will go off and then come straight back on..Any thoughts? Cheers

						Super ModeratorThe reasoning behind my question is every reference I can find to that fault refers to the SWC. The ones closest to that specific fault refer to the stereo, so I wonder if your car thinks there's supposed to be buttons on the wheel and there isn't?
The threads that show genuine faults all seem to point to the clock spring.
